久久精品人人爽,华人av在线,亚洲性视频网站,欧美专区一二三

python發送郵件怎么實現

141次閱讀
沒有評論

共計 1032 個字符,預計需要花費 3 分鐘才能閱讀完成。

要實現 Python 發送郵件,可以使用 smtplib 庫。以下是一個簡單的示例代碼:

import smtplib
from email.mime.text import MIMEText
from email.utils import formataddr
def send_email(sender_email, sender_password, receiver_email, subject, message):
msg = MIMEText(message, 'plain', 'utf-8')
msg['From'] = formataddr(('Sender', sender_email))
msg['To'] = formataddr(('Receiver', receiver_email))
msg['Subject'] = subject
try:
server = smtplib.SMTP('smtp.gmail.com', 587)
server.starttls()
server.login(sender_email, sender_password)
server.sendmail(sender_email, [receiver_email], msg.as_string())
server.quit()
print('郵件發送成功')
except Exception as e:
print('郵件發送失敗')
print(e)
# 發件人郵箱和密碼
sender_email = 'your_sender_email@gmail.com'
sender_password = 'your_sender_password'
# 收件人郵箱
receiver_email = 'receiver_email@gmail.com'
# 郵件主題和內容
subject = '測試郵件'
message = '這是一封測試郵件。'
# 發送郵件
send_email(sender_email, sender_password, receiver_email, subject, message)

注意,這個示例使用了 Gmail 作為 郵件服務器 ,如果使用其他郵件 服務器 ,需要相應調整server = smtplib.SMTP('smtp.gmail.com', 587) 這一行代碼。
另外,為了保護賬戶安全,建議使用應用專用密碼或授權碼代替郵箱密碼進行登錄??梢栽卩]箱設置中生成和管理應用專用密碼或授權碼。
此外,還可以通過添加附件、HTML 內容等進一步定制郵件內容。

丸趣 TV 網 – 提供最優質的資源集合!

正文完
 
丸趣
版權聲明:本站原創文章,由 丸趣 2023-12-21發表,共計1032字。
轉載說明:除特殊說明外本站除技術相關以外文章皆由網絡搜集發布,轉載請注明出處。
評論(沒有評論)
主站蜘蛛池模板: 阿坝| 连平县| 沙田区| 建平县| 罗田县| 临桂县| 龙泉市| 道真| 灌阳县| 怀远县| 平山县| 彰武县| 珲春市| 万州区| 宁都县| 满洲里市| 哈密市| 遂溪县| 三河市| 亚东县| 双鸭山市| 湾仔区| 内丘县| 石台县| 开阳县| 榆社县| 桦川县| 沂水县| 嘉峪关市| 平定县| 瑞安市| 灌南县| 保德县| 陕西省| 凤山市| 隆子县| 开阳县| 乌拉特后旗| 寿光市| 武清区| 酒泉市|